List the steps to convert cfg to pda

WebGrammar Editor Convert to PDA (LL) Step to Completion Create Selected Done? Export Production S->a a b Table Text Size Created 'FLAP File Input Help Grammar Editor Convert to PDA (LL) ... Microsoft Word - Convert_CFG_to_NPDA (2).docx Created Date: 7/19/2016 3:05:29 PM ... Web9 jan. 2016 · The standard construction to convert a PDA into a CFG is usually called the triplet construction. In that construction the triplet [ p, A, q] represents a computation from …

Automata CFG to PDA Conversion - thedeveloperblog.com

WebList the steps to convert CFG to PDA. Remember 11 7. DefineCNF. Remember 9 8. DefinePDA. Remember 10 9. DefineNPDA. Remember 10 10. Differentiatebetween deterministic and nondeterministic PDA. Understand 10 UNIT - IV 1. Writethe Turing Machine model. Apply 12 2. Explainthe moves in Turing Machine Understand 12 3. WebConverting a PDA to a CFG Samya Daleh 888 subscribers Subscribe 45 Share 24K views 6 years ago Context-free languages I show an algorithm that let's you convert any PDA … phm1 vector https://digitalpipeline.net

cfg-to-pda/pda-converter.cpp at main · oanhgle/cfg-to-pda

WebThe right hand side of a rule consists of: i. Either a single terminal, e.g. A → a. ii. Or two variables, e.g. A → BC, iii. Or the rule S → , if is in the language. iv. The start symbol S may appear only on the left hand side of rules. Given a CFG G, we show how to convert it to a CNF grammar G0generating the same language. WebWe present here the proof for an alternative procedure to convert a Push Down Automata (PDA) into a Context Free Grammar (CFG). The procedure involves intermediate conversion to a single state PDA. In view of the authors, this conversion is conceptually intuitive and can serve as a teaching aid for the relevant topics. Web20 dec. 2024 · GNF produces the same language as generated by CFG; How to convert CFG to GNF – Step 1. If the given grammar is not in CNF, convert it to CNF. You can refer following article to convert CFG to CNF: Converting Context Free Grammar to Chomsky Normal Form . Step 2. Change the names of non terminal symbols to A 1 till A N in … tsunades friend that pain killed name

Equivalence of Pushdown Automata with Context-Free Grammar

Category:Convert CFG to PDA (LL) - JFLAP

Tags:List the steps to convert cfg to pda

List the steps to convert cfg to pda

Convert PDF to CFG DocHub

WebConvert PDA to CFG • Given a PDA THOUSAND = (Q, €, F, 6, qO, ZO, {}), we construct a CFG GRAM = (V, €, P, S) – V = {[q, A, p] q, p are by Q, AN is in F+{S}} – P is a se… Web#CFGtoPDAConversion, #ContextFreeGrammartoPushDownAutomataConversion, #cfgtopdainhindi #CFGtoPDA #TheoryOfComputation #AutomataTheory …

List the steps to convert cfg to pda

Did you know?

WebConverting CFGs to PDAs Given a CFG , we will construct a PDA that simulates leftmost derivations in . Main ideas: Each left-sentential form of is of the form 𝐴 , where: is all terminals, 𝐴is the variable that will be replaced in the next derivation step, and is some string that can include both variables and WebThe steps for obtaining personal organiser from the CFG area unit as follows: Step 1: Amend the CFG outputs into GNF outputs. Step 2: there will be only 1 state on the pushdown automata. Step 3: The CFG's initial image area unit getting to be the PDA's image. Step 4: Add the appropriate rule to non-terminal symbols: δ (q, ε, A) = (q, α)

WebPushdown automata is a way to implement a CFG in the same way we design DFA for a regular grammar. A DFA can remember a finite amount of information, but a PDA can remember an infinite amount of information. … WebStep 1 Add New Start Variable Step 2 Remove All ε Rules Step 3 Remove All Unit Rules Step 4 Standard Form Conversion

WebMy professor doesn't do a very good job at explaining the process of converting a PDA to a CFG. Can someone help explain it? The way I see it (but it produces wrong results) is each production is created by an instruction. And if it is a push instruction, then the production is the items on the stack plus the input symbol. WebCFG → PDA Construction Step One: Create a 3-State PDA. The states are q start, q loop and q accept.; q accept is an accept state.; q start transitions to q loop with the rule ε, ε → S$; q loop transitions to itself with the rules ε, A → w (for each rule A → w) and a, a → ε (for each terminal a).; q loop transitions to q accept with the rule ε, $ → ε

WebThis PDA can then be exported by clicking the Export button and saved o into its own le. Let us nally ensure that this PDA produces the same results as the CFG. By having both the CFG and the PDA open at the same time we can try and brute force parse on the grammar side and use the multiple run option on the PDA side. Here is a screenshot that

WebThis is same as: “implementing a CFG using a PDA” Converting a CFG into a PDA Main idea: The PDA simulates the leftmost derivation on a given w, and upon consuming it fully it either arrives at acceptance (by emppyty stack) or non-acceptance. Steps: 1. Push the right hand side of the production onto the stack, phm 2022 abstractWebConversion of CFG to PDA consists of five steps. The steps are as follows: Convert the CFG productions into GNF. There will only be one state, "q," on the PDA. The CFG's first symbol will also be the PDA's initial symbol. Include the following rule for non-terminal … tsunade s deathWebStep 1: Convert the given productions of CFG into GNF. Step 2: The PDA will only have one state {q}. Step 3: The initial symbol of CFG will be the initial symbol in the PDA. … phm 2021 conferenceWeb21 mei 2024 · Step 1. Eliminate start symbol from RHS. If start symbol S is at the RHS of any production in the grammar, create a new production as: S0->S. where S0 is the new start symbol. Step 2. Eliminate null, unit and useless productions. If CFG contains null, unit or useless production rules, eliminate them. phm 2022 conferenceWebConversion of CFG to PDA Procedure 1) Convert a given CFG to GNF 2) From the start symbol q 0 without seeing any input push start symbol S to stack and move to q 1 … tsunade\u0027s grandmotherWebhas a context-free grammar (CFG) describing it. This chapter is mainly about context-free grammars, although a brief introduction to push-down automata is also provided. The next chapter will treat push-down automata in greater detail, and also describe algorithms to convert PDAs to CFGs and vice versa. The theory behind CFGs and PDAs tsunagu community idWebAnother way of writing that is you can say, u goes to v if there are a bunch of one-step moves that you can make which take you from u to v. And that whole sequence is called a derivation of v from u. That's a sequence of steps that you go through doing these substitutions one by one to take you from u to v, according to the rules of the grammar. tsunade vs 4th raikage arm wrestling